About The Role
Washroom Service Driver – Bolton.
£12.92 per hour (approx. £26,879 + Bonus (OTE £28,079) per year).
40 hours guaranteed, permanent.
Monday to Friday. No scheduled weekends.
The Washroom Service Driver role at phs will involve:
- Collect feminine hygiene bins and nappy bins within customer premises
- Service and replace hygiene products
- Complete compliance documentation (digital and paper‑based)
- Deliver professional and courteous customer service
- Return to the depot once a week to unload collected waste
The ideal candidate for a Washroom Service Driver at phs will have:
- Full UK Manual Driving Licence (held 12+ months)
- Maximum 6 points (no DR/DD/CD/TT/IN/AC endorsements in last 5 years)
- Able to work within a 6am‑6pm window (40 hours per week)
- Reliable, safety‑conscious and professional
- Good attention to detail
